πŸ“‹ Clinical Stem β€” Gradual Hearing Loss in an Older Adult
A 68-year-old retired factory worker presents with gradually worsening hearing over 2 years β€” differentiate age-related hearing loss, noise-induced loss, and wax from acoustic neuroma
"Mr Brian Whitfield, 68 years old, retired factory worker (metal press operator for 35 years). He presents with his wife who is frustrated that he keeps "missing" what she says. He reports gradual hearing difficulty over 2 years β€” worse in noisy environments. He has noticed tinnitus in both ears. He feels he hears low-pitched sounds better than high-pitched ones. He denies any dizziness or vertigo. His wife confirms he turns the television up very loudly. He has no ear infections, ear discharge, or pain. He takes atorvastatin and amlodipine."
The combination of gradual bilateral high-frequency hearing loss + prolonged occupational noise exposure + bilateral tinnitus without vertigo is the classic presentation of mixed ARHL and noise-induced hearing loss. The primary clinical task is to exclude acoustic neuroma (typically unilateral), sudden SNHL (emergency), cerumen impaction (fully reversible), and otosclerosis. This patient needs audiology and audiogram, not urgent ENT referral.
Scenario A β€” Cerumen Impaction 45-year-old with sudden unilateral hearing loss + fullness + aural pressure after swimming. Otoscopy shows complete wax occlusion. Ear drops 2 weeks then microsuction if persists. Fully reversible.
Scenario B β€” Sudden SNHL (Emergency) 55-year-old with acute unilateral hearing loss on waking, tinnitus, no vertigo. Developed within 72 hours. Same-day ENT referral; oral prednisolone 1 mg/kg/day Γ— 7–14 days without waiting for ENT.
Scenario C β€” Acoustic Neuroma (Vestibular Schwannoma) 52-year-old with progressive unilateral hearing loss + ipsilateral tinnitus + subtle balance disturbance. MRI IAM (internal auditory meatus) β€” gadolinium-enhanced. ENT urgent referral.
Scenario D β€” Otosclerosis 38-year-old woman, bilateral progressive conductive hearing loss, family history of hearing loss. Otoscopy normal; Rinne negative bilaterally; Weber lateralises to affected ear. ENT for stapedectomy assessment.
Scenario E β€” Glue Ear / OME (Child or Adult) 8-year-old with recurrent otitis media, school difficulties, bilateral flat tympanograms. Watchful waiting 3 months; grommets if persistent with educational impact. Adenoidectomy consideration.
Key variables Onset (sudden vs gradual), laterality (unilateral vs bilateral), associated tinnitus/vertigo, occupational noise history, ear symptoms (pain, discharge, fullness, pressure), age, family history of hearing loss, medication review (ototoxic drugs), previous ear surgery.

The history is the primary diagnostic tool in hearing loss β€” the pattern of onset, laterality, associated symptoms, and occupational background often allows clinical categorisation before the examination. The single most important discriminator is sudden vs gradual onset: sudden unilateral hearing loss (within 72 hours) is a same-day ENT emergency requiring oral steroids immediately, regardless of other features.

Sudden unilateral hearing loss (within 72 hours)Sudden SNHL (sudden sensorineural hearing loss) has a time-critical treatment window. If oral prednisolone is started within 2 weeks, over 70% of cases partially or fully recover. Beyond 2 weeks, the prognosis is significantly worse. The aetiology is often idiopathic (presumed viral or vascular) β€” treatment should not wait for ENT appointment.Same-day ENT + start prednisolone 1 mg/kg/day today
Unilateral hearing loss + ipsilateral tinnitus (any duration)The classic presentation of vestibular schwannoma (acoustic neuroma) β€” a slow-growing benign tumour of the 8th cranial nerve. It is not immediately life-threatening but can cause permanent deafness, facial palsy (7th nerve compression), and brainstem compression if large. MRI IAM with gadolinium is the diagnostic test β€” audiogram alone is insufficient for exclusion.Urgent ENT referral + MRI IAM
Pulsatile tinnitus (synchronous with heartbeat)Pulsatile tinnitus indicates a vascular cause β€” glomus tympanicum/jugulare tumour, carotid artery disease, AVM, or high jugular bulb. These require vascular imaging urgently. Do not reassure pulsatile tinnitus as benign without exclusion of a vascular lesion.Urgent ENT referral + vascular imaging
Painless foul-smelling unilateral ear discharge + hearing lossCholesteatoma is a destructive, locally invasive epidermal cyst growing into the middle ear and mastoid β€” it erodes bone, destroys ossicles, and can cause facial palsy, labyrinthitis, meningitis, or brain abscess if untreated. Surgical treatment is mandatory. Painlessness is a paradoxically alarming feature β€” pain usually indicates infection, not cholesteatoma itself.Urgent ENT referral β€” surgical removal
Unilateral facial weakness + hearing loss or ear painRamsay Hunt syndrome (herpes zoster oticus) β€” VZV reactivation in the geniculate ganglion causing facial palsy + ear pain + vesicles in the ear + hearing loss + vertigo. Requires urgent antiviral therapy (aciclovir) + prednisolone within 72 hours for best facial recovery. Otherwise: urgent ENT for acoustic neuroma with 7th nerve compression.Same-day ENT β€” antiviral + steroid within 72 hours
Ear pain with no obvious cause in an older adult (especially smoker)Referred otalgia from a pharyngeal or hypopharyngeal cancer is a classical and often missed presentation β€” the ear is innervated by branches that also supply the pharynx and tongue base. Any smoker over 45 with persistent ear pain without an obvious otological cause requires urgent ENT throat examination and nasendoscopy.Urgent ENT β€” exclude pharyngeal malignancy

Triage in hearing loss starts with a single question: was the onset sudden (within 72 hours)? If yes β€” this is a same-day ENT emergency and oral prednisolone must be started today, before the ENT appointment, because the steroid treatment window closes at 2 weeks. Every other triage decision flows from the laterality and associated features.

Otoscopy is mandatory β€” cerumen impaction is the commonest reversible cause of hearing loss and can only be found by looking. The Rinne and Weber tuning fork tests (512 Hz) differentiate conductive from sensorineural hearing loss with over 80% sensitivity and must follow otoscopy in every patient with hearing loss where the canal is patent.

A β€” Diagnosable / Manageable in Primary Care
GP can manage initially

Cerumen Impaction (Wax)

Commonest reversible cause. Confirmed on otoscopy. Treatment: olive oil drops twice daily Γ— 2–4 weeks β†’ microsuction. Never syringe if drum perforation suspected. Fully reversible β€” reassess hearing after treatment before any further investigation.

Age-Related Hearing Loss (Presbycusis)

Bilateral progressive high-frequency SNHL from the 50s onwards. Over 50% prevalence in adults over 75. Rinne positive bilaterally; Weber central; 4 kHz + higher frequencies affected on audiogram. Treated with NHS bilateral hearing aids (free; threshold β‰₯40 dB in better ear).

Noise-Induced Hearing Loss (NIHL)

Bilateral high-frequency SNHL with characteristic 4 kHz notch on audiogram from occupational or recreational noise. Often combined with ARHL in older patients. Hearing protection advice mandatory. Industrial injury compensation (IIDB) may be applicable.

B β€” Refer to ENT / Audiology
Specialist needed

Acoustic Neuroma (Vestibular Schwannoma)

Benign slow-growing tumour of CN VIII. Unilateral SNHL + ipsilateral tinnitus Β± disequilibrium. Normal otoscopy. MRI IAM with gadolinium diagnostic. Management: watch and wait (small, slow-growing), stereotactic radiosurgery (Gamma Knife), or surgical removal based on size and patient factors.

Otosclerosis

Progressive bilateral conductive loss from abnormal bony remodelling around the stapes. Typical: young woman 30s–40s, family history, may worsen in pregnancy. Rinne negative bilaterally, normal otoscopy. CT temporal bones confirms. Treatment: stapedectomy (highly effective) or bone-anchored hearing aid.

Menière's Disease

Episodic triad: vertigo (20 min–12 hours) + unilateral fluctuating SNHL + tinnitus. Low-frequency SNHL early, progresses to permanent. Confirmed by ENT. Treatment: salt restriction, betahistine, diuretics; intratympanic treatment in refractory cases.

C β€” Emergency β€” Act Now
Same-day action

Sudden SNHL

Onset within 72 hours, unilateral SNHL β‰₯30 dB at 3 frequencies. Start prednisolone 1 mg/kg/day (max 60 mg) today β€” do not wait for ENT. Same-day ENT referral for intratympanic steroid injection consideration. 60–70% partial or full recovery if treated within 2 weeks.

Ramsay Hunt Syndrome

VZV reactivation in the geniculate ganglion. Ear pain + ipsilateral facial palsy + ear canal vesicles. Treat within 72 hours: aciclovir 800 mg 5Γ— daily + prednisolone 1 mg/kg/day Γ— 10 days. Facial palsy recovery worse than Bell's palsy β€” urgency of treatment is critical.

Cholesteatoma with Complication

Facial palsy, meningism, or cerebellar signs in a patient with chronic ear disease = cholesteatoma complication (labyrinthitis, facial nerve erosion, intracranial extension) β†’ 999 immediately.

Industrial Injuries Disablement Benefit (IIDB) is payable to workers who developed hearing loss from occupational noise exposure. A retired factory worker with 35 years of noise exposure without adequate protection has a strong claim. Citizens Advice or the DWP website provides guidance on the claims process.

IIDB compensation is a legal entitlement β€” failure to mention it is a significant missed opportunity for the patient

Hearing loss is the largest single modifiable dementia risk factor (Lancet Commission 2020 β€” 8% population attributable fraction). The mechanism is twofold: increased cognitive load from straining to understand speech diverts resources from memory; and reduced auditory stimulation accelerates auditory cortex atrophy. Hearing aid use significantly slows cognitive decline.

For patients resistant to hearing aids on grounds of stigma β€” framing the device as a brain health intervention sidesteps the identity issue entirely and significantly improves uptake rates.

Noise-induced hearing loss from occupational exposure is an Industrial Injury under the Industrial Injuries Disablement Benefit (IIDB) scheme. Workers who developed NIHL from their occupation can claim financial compensation through the DWP β€” no time limit on making a claim for occupational NIHL.

The GP's role is to document the occupational history clearly in the clinical notes and advise the patient of their entitlement. Direct them to Citizens Advice or DWP. Audiological evidence from the formal audiogram (including the 4 kHz notch) will support the claim.

The single most common barrier to hearing aid uptake in older men is stigma β€” equating the device with disability and old age. Modern NHS hearing aids are digital, many are in-the-canal (virtually invisible), and many stream directly to smartphones via Bluetooth. They bear no resemblance to the bulky beige devices of a previous generation.

Correcting the patient's mental image of what a hearing aid looks like is a specific and immediately impactful intervention. The dementia prevention reframe additionally removes the stigma by repositioning the hearing aid as a health device rather than a disability aid.
